We had a great time enjoying nature and serenity in this lovely cabin. There's a huge screened-in porch/balcony overlooking the charming creek. Bring folding chairs so you can sit on the balcony and take in the sights and sounds. The kitchen was spacious and very well appointed. The beds were super comfy (firmer beds upstairs, softer bed downstairs). The interior was immaculate with very comfortable furniture, great heating and cooling, and no bugs (which is sometimes an issue in remote cabins). For all you city folks (like me), there are giant spiders, but they're all outside and won't bother you. They just sit on the webs and look beautiful. It's pitch black at night, so be prepared for that (especially if you're arriving after dark). There's also spotty cell service and internet given the remote location, but that's the whole point of unplugging at a cozy cabin. Enjoy the time away from phones and laptops. If you love screens, don't worry, there's a gigantic 85-inch TV in the main room (and smaller TVs in each bedroom). The bathroom has a deep soaker tub and a nice shower with good water pressure. Note that there are stairs and step-ups throughout, so it might not be the best spot for folks with mobility limitations. Otherwise, it's fantastic. Perhaps the best part - the hot tub! It was luxurious. And the host was super responsive and helpful. We'll definitely be back!
